How to prepare for the financial aspect of home-buying

Before you even begin searching for houses, you need to be aware of the financial implications of buying a home. Contact a lender to inquire about being able to prequalify you for a loan. It will help you decide how much you can get and what kind of house you can afford. It will also help when it's time to put in an offer on a house as sellers will prefer buyers who are prequalified , as they know that those buyers are serious and capable of completing the purchase.

It's important to know how much you can afford to get from a loan. Additionally, you should consider other expenses like closing fees and down payments. Closing fees are typically due at the time of closing (hence the name) and cover things like closing fees, loan origination fees such as title search charges, and appraisal fees; these costs vary based on where you live , but generally are between 2% and 5percent of the overall amount of the loan. The down payments must be paid upfront to the seller to get an offer. Certain lenders may require PMI or private mortgage insurance (PMI) in the event that the down payment exceeds 20%..

Finding Your Perfect Home

If you've a better understanding of what it will cost you to buy a house in Bloomington, IL, it's time to begin searching for your dream home! When searching for houses online or visiting open houses, think about what features are most important to you--do you want more bedrooms or bathrooms? Do you desire a finished basement? A big backyard? Once you've decided which amenities are not negotiable in your dream home, narrow your search accordingly. After that, go to homes that match your requirements. It is helpful to record any improvements or repairs which are required in negotiations with sellers. It is possible to engage an inspector to check the property and give you details regarding any potential issues prior to deciding to make an offer. This will ensure that there's no surprise after the closing.
